In today's digital age, setting up an online store is more accessible than ever. Whether you're an entrepreneur looking to expand your business or someone with a passion for selling products, an online store can open doors to a global market. This beginner's guide will walk you through the essential steps to build your own online store from scratch.

Table of Contents

  1. Planning Your Online Store
  2. Choosing the Right E-commerce Platform
  3. Registering a Domain Name
  4. Setting Up Web Hosting
  5. Designing Your Online Store
  6. Adding Products
  7. Setting Up Payment Gateways
  8. Configuring Shipping Options
  9. Establishing Legal Policies
  10. Testing Your Online Store
  11. Launching Your Online Store
  12. Marketing Strategies
  13. Analyzing and Optimizing
  14. Conclusion
1. Planning Your Online Store

Before diving into the technical aspects, it's crucial to plan your online store thoroughly.

Define Your Niche and Target Audience

  • Identify Your Products/Services: Decide what you want to sell. It could be physical goods, digital products, or services.
  • Research the Market: Analyze competitors and identify gaps in the market.
  • Understand Your Audience: Determine who your ideal customers are, their preferences, and buying behaviors.
Set Clear Goals

  • Short-term Goals: Initial sales targets, website launch date.
  • Long-term Goals: Brand recognition, customer loyalty, expansion plans.
2. Choosing the Right E-commerce Platform

An e-commerce platform is the backbone of your online store.

Popular Platforms

  • Shopify: User-friendly, hosted solution with various themes and apps.
  • WooCommerce: A WordPress plugin that's flexible and customizable.
  • BigCommerce: Scalable platform suitable for growing businesses.
  • Magento: Open-source platform for advanced users.
Factors to Consider

  • Ease of Use: Especially important if you're not tech-savvy.
  • Customization Options: Ability to tailor the store to your brand.
  • Scalability: Can the platform grow with your business?
  • Cost: Consider transaction fees, subscription costs, and additional expenses.
3. Registering a Domain Name

Your domain name is your store's address on the internet.

Tips for Choosing a Domain Name

  • Keep It Simple and Memorable: Short and easy to spell.
  • Use Keywords: Incorporate relevant keywords if possible.
  • Choose the Right Extension: .com is most common, but others like .net or .store may be suitable.
Registering the Domain

  • Use registrars like GoDaddy, Namecheap, or register directly through your e-commerce platform if available.
4. Setting Up Web Hosting

If you choose a self-hosted platform like WooCommerce, you'll need web hosting.

Types of Hosting

  • Shared Hosting: Affordable but with limited resources.
  • VPS Hosting: More resources and control.
  • Dedicated Hosting: Exclusive server for your site.
Recommended Hosting Providers

  • Bluehost
  • SiteGround
  • HostGator
Ensure the hosting provider offers reliable uptime, security features, and good customer support.

5. Designing Your Online Store

An attractive and user-friendly design enhances customer experience.

Selecting a Theme or Template

  • Choose a theme that aligns with your brand and industry.
  • Ensure the theme is responsive (works on all devices).
Customizing Your Store

  • Logo and Branding: Use consistent colors, fonts, and imagery.
  • Navigation: Create intuitive menus and categories.
  • Home Page: Highlight best-selling products and special offers.
6. Adding Products

Now, it's time to showcase what you're selling.

Product Listings

  • High-Quality Images: Use clear, professional photos from multiple angles.
  • Detailed Descriptions: Include features, benefits, and specifications.
  • Pricing: Be transparent about costs, include any taxes or fees.
Inventory Management

  • Keep track of stock levels.
  • Set up notifications for low stock alerts.
7. Setting Up Payment Gateways

Payment gateways process transactions securely.

Common Payment Gateways

  • PayPal
  • Stripe
  • Square
Considerations

  • Transaction Fees: Understand the cost per transaction.
  • Security: Ensure the gateway is PCI compliant.
  • Customer Convenience: Offer multiple payment options.
8. Configuring Shipping Options

Provide clear shipping information to avoid cart abandonment.

Shipping Methods

  • Flat Rate: A fixed fee for all orders.
  • Weight-Based: Costs vary based on order weight.
  • Real-Time Carrier Rates: Integrate with carriers like UPS or FedEx.
Setting Shipping Zones

  • Define regions you ship to and any variations in costs.
9. Establishing Legal Policies

Protect your business and build trust with customers.

Essential Policies

  • Privacy Policy: Explain how customer data is used.
  • Terms and Conditions: Outline the rules for using your site.
  • Return and Refund Policy: Clarify the process for returns.
Compliance

  • Ensure policies comply with regulations like GDPR if serving EU customers.
10. Testing Your Online Store

Before going live, test all aspects of your store.

Functional Testing

  • Navigation: Ensure all links and menus work correctly.
  • Checkout Process: Test adding items to the cart and completing a purchase.
  • Payment Processing: Verify transactions go through smoothly.
Usability Testing

  • Get feedback from friends or beta users on the shopping experience.
11. Launching Your Online Store

With everything in place, it's time to launch.

Final Checks

  • Review all content for errors.
  • Ensure all integrations (email, analytics) are functioning.
Announce Your Launch

  • Use social media, email newsletters, and press releases to spread the word.
12. Marketing Strategies

Attract visitors and convert them into customers.

Search Engine Optimization (SEO)

  • Keyword Research: Use tools like Google Keyword Planner.
  • On-Page SEO: Optimize titles, meta descriptions, and content.
  • Content Marketing: Start a blog to drive organic traffic.
Social Media Marketing

  • Engage with your audience on platforms like Facebook, Instagram, and Twitter.
  • Use paid advertising to reach a wider audience.
Email Marketing

  • Build an email list with signup forms.
  • Send newsletters, promotions, and personalized recommendations.
13. Analyzing and Optimizing

Use data to improve your store's performance.

Analytics Tools

  • Google Analytics: Track visitor behavior and traffic sources.
  • Platform Analytics: Utilize built-in analytics from your e-commerce platform.
Key Metrics

  • Conversion Rate: Percentage of visitors who make a purchase.
  • Bounce Rate: Visitors who leave without interacting.
  • Average Order Value: Average amount spent per transaction.
Continuous Improvement

  • A/B test different elements like product pages or calls to action.
  • Gather customer feedback for insights.
14. Conclusion

Building an online store is an exciting venture that requires careful planning and execution. By following this guide, you're well on your way to establishing a successful online presence. Remember that persistence and adaptability are key. Keep learning, stay updated with e-commerce trends, and continuously strive to enhance your customers' shopping experience.

Good luck on your e-commerce journey!

Additional Resources

  • E-commerce Platforms Comparison: [Link to article]
  • Beginner's Guide to SEO: [Link to article]
  • Email Marketing Best Practices: [Link to article]